聊聊JDK19特性之虚拟线程 | 京东云技术团队
????相较于平台线程而言,虚拟线程是一种非常廉价和丰富的线程,可以说虚拟线程的数量是一种近乎于无限多的线程,它对硬件的利用率接近于最好,在相同硬件配置服务器的情况下,虚拟线程比使用平台线程具备更高的并发性,从而提升整个应用程序的吞吐量。如果说平台线程和系统线程调度为1:1的方式,虚拟线程则采用M:N的...
华硕主板&AMD助力数字化发展 用科技守护文化遗产
在数字化时代,科技的力量成为守护文化遗产、延续人类记忆的新利器。华硕携手AMD,在新维畅想文化遗产保护工作中发挥了巨大的作用。这是一次数字化时代对文化遗产的守护,也是科技与人文的美好交融。科技的力量成为守护文化遗产、延续人类记忆的新利器ProArtX670E-CREATORWIFI主板创造无限一家高科技公司,新维畅想,...
987页的Java面试宝典,看完才发现,应届生求职也没那么难
什么是反射机制?package有什么作用?如何实现类似于C语言中函数指针的功能?面向对象技术面向对象与面向过程有什么区别?面向对象有哪些特征?面向对象的开发方式有什么优点什么是继承?组合和继承有什么区别?多态的实现机制是什么?重载和覆盖有什么区别?...多线程什么是线程?它与进程有什么区别?为什么要使用多线程?...
这些年背过的面试题 — Kafka 篇
消息队列的作用:异步、削峰填谷、解耦中小型公司,技术挑战不是特别高,用RabbitMQ(开源、社区活跃)是不错的选择;大型公司,基础架构研发实力较强,用RocketMQ(Java二次开发)是很好的选择。如果是大数据领域的实时计算、日志采集等场景,用Kafka是业内标准的,绝对没问题,社区活跃度很高,绝对不会黄,何况几乎...
如何让自己在“输”的时候仍然获益?
然而,投资并无圣杯。AQR的创始人Asness就认为通过虚值期权实现的尾部对冲在很多时候是无效的策略,其费用高昂,保护作用有限。10管理风险而非收益投资的第一原则是:永远不要亏(大)钱。第二条原则是:永远不要忘记第一条原则。对于投资者而言,最重要的风险,是永久损失的可能性风险。
在java中守护线程和本地线程有什么区别
也可以理解为守护线程是JVM自动创建的线程(但不一定),用户线程是程序创建的线程;比如JVM的垃圾回收线程是一个守护线程,当所有线程已经撤离,不再产生垃圾,守护线程自然就没事可干了,当垃圾回收线程是Java虚拟机上仅剩的线程时,Java虚拟机会自动离开(www.e993.com)2024年7月27日。扩展:ThreadDump打印出来的线程信息,含有daemon字样的线程即为守护...
...Android常用布局、Java重入锁、守护线程、 SharedPreference...
(1)重进入:1.定义:重进入是指任意线程在获取到锁之后,再次获取该锁而不会被该锁所阻塞。关联一个线程持有者+计数器,重入意味着锁操作的颗粒度为“线程”。2.需要解决两个问题:线程再次获取锁:锁需要识别获取锁的现场是否为当前占据锁的线程,如果是,则再次成功获取;锁的最终释放:线程重复n次获取锁,随后在第...
多线程开发必看:守护线程优雅地停止用户线程
1守护线程的意义在java多线程开发中,有两类线程,分别是UserThread(用户线程)和DaemonThread(守护线程)。用户线程很好理解,我们日常开发中编写的业务逻辑代码,运行起来都是一个个用户线程。而守护线程相对来说则要特别理解一下。守护线程,类似于操作系统里面是守护进程。由于Java语言机制是构建在JVM的基础之上...
额!Java中用户线程和守护线程区别这么大?
PS:Thread.currentThread()的意思是获取执行当前代码的线程实例。主动修改为守护线程守护线程(DaemonThread)也被称之为后台线程或服务线程,守护线程是为用户线程服务的,当程序中的用户线程全部执行结束之后,守护线程也会跟随结束。守护线程的角色就像“服务员”,而用户线程的角色就像“顾客”,当“顾客”全部走了...
预算6000元应该入手什么价位的CPU
酷睿i5-7600同样基于Kabylake打造,14nm的制程经过一代产品优化可以提供更好的性能,i5-7600配备了四核心四线程,默认频率3.5GHz,睿频最大可以达到4.1GHz,三级缓存6MB,可以输出稳定的处理器性能。核显同样搭载了HD630,可以保证日常使用需求。Intel酷睿i57600...